Fuzzy’s Taco Shop to open a second location on the Wichita State campus

Braeburn Square

When Fuzzy’s Taco Shop first announced plans to Wichita, they mentioned there would be a possibility of 2-3 locations in town.

Fast forward to a couple of weeks ago, I was at a meeting at Wichita State and one of their execs mentioned there would be some big news coming in the way of Braeburn Square which is the new retail complex at the Wichita State University campus.

Braeburn Square currently houses Starbucks, the Shocker Store, and Meritrust Credit Union. It’ll soon be time to add a fourth establishment to that list.

Fuzzy’s Taco Shop recently announced plans to open their second Wichita location at Braeburn Square. It will be 4,200 square feet with seating for roughly 180 people along with a huge patio. This restaurant will also have a bar and ample TVs around the walls. They plan to be open by the summer of 2019.

This could be the perfect establishment for students on campus. There have been a ton of changes to Wichita State since I graduated but they have all been for the better.
